What problem does it solve?

This Skill helps you carry out an already-approved implementation plan without wasting time on replanning, scope expansion, or unnecessary refactors.

Core Features & Use Cases

  • Plan-driven execution: Reads the approved plan, checks completed items, and continues from the next unfinished task.
  • Scoped implementation: Keeps changes minimal, follows existing architecture, and updates only what the plan requires.
  • Verification and recovery: Runs relevant tests and checks, reports mismatches clearly, and stops when the plan and codebase diverge.
  • Use case: A developer hands over a ticket plan and asks the AI to implement the next pending phase while preserving the current design and validation flow.
